Durham's day-to-day fact for dogs
Our environment swings. July and August bring lengthy strings of days over 90 levels with pavement that french fries paws rapidly. Pollen spikes can cause itch flare ups in springtime. We likewise get cold snaps with freezing rainfall that transform sidewalks slippery. Excellent pet dog pedestrians plan around all of it. They start previously in warmth, usage shaded greenways like Sandy Creek Park, lug water, switch to sniffy decompression strolls in tree cover, and reduce midday stretches if required. When ice hits, they choose more secure paths, wipe paws, and watch for salt irritation.
The developed setting forms options as well. Downtown has tighter walkways and even more sound. Woodcroft and Hope Valley deal calmer cul-de-sacs and loops with fully grown trees. The American Cigarette Path is superb for right, consistent gas mileage, however it can be busy with bikes. A wise dog walker checks out the map, then reviews your canine, and incorporates both to get the right sort of exercise.
The top 7 benefits of employing a specialist dog walker in Durham
1. Regular, breed ideal workout that fits the season
Every dog requires movement, yet not the exact same kind or dosage. A 9 years of age bulldog does not need what a 10 month old Aussie needs. A professional pet dog strolling solution brings that calibration. In summer, my walkers in Durham shift high drive rounding up types to unethical, quit and smell paths near Third Fork Creek in the late morning, after that do any aerobic work in the cooler evening port. Elderly pets get short, constant potty brake with gentle strolls and remainder. On light fall days, we extend period and surface, making use of ground cover and brand-new aromas as brain job. Over a month, that equilibrium of strength and remainder improves stamina without overwhelming joints or overheating, specifically vital on humid days that compromise cooling.
2. Noontime relief, healthier food digestion, less accidents
Gastrointestinal comfort and bladder health enhance with routine relief. Young puppies under 6 months seldom make it longer than 4 hours without a break, no matter how much you desire they could. Numerous grown-up pet dogs can hold it, yet at an expense, especially elders or those on certain medications. Dependable lunchtime walks reduce urinary system system infection danger and aid control defecation. In my notes, households with a regular 20 to 30 minute midday stroll saw interior accidents drop to near no within 2 weeks, also for just recently taken on pet dogs that were still resolving in. That predictability lowers anxiousness and prevents the type of frenzied energy that develops when a dog has to wait as well long.
3. Better behavior through targeted psychological work
A tired canine is a myth if all you do is run them until their legs totter. The brain needs private dog walks a work. Great pet dog pedestrians make use of scent games at trailheads, pattern games at peaceful corners, and straightforward impulse control on chain to bring arousal down, after that maintain it there. We will request a rest and eye get in touch with at busy crosswalks on Ninth Road, incentive calmness while a bus goes by, and tip off the walkway for room if a skateboard strategies. Ten deliberate reps succeeded issue more than a frantic mile. With time, pulling decreases, reactivity softens, and your pet dog learns how to recover from sudden noise or groups. That pays off in the real world, like outside dishes at Geer Street or waiting in line at a veterinarian clinic.
4. Social confidence without chaos
Everyone photos their canine performing at a park with a lots new close friends. Some grow there, some obtain overwhelmed, and a few learn bad practices fast. Professional pet dog pedestrians in Durham, NC handle social exposure tactically. If a pet takes pleasure in business, we pair suitable walking buddies by dimension, energy, and chain good manners, maintain groups little, and select routes with adequate width for comfortable side by side activity, like sections of Duke Forest where permitted. For pets that favor area, we set up solo walks and path them at off peak times. The result is social self-confidence built on favorable, controlled experiences, not forced proximity.
5. Early discovery of wellness problems and safer walks
Walkers hang around seeing your dog step, smell, and get rid of every day. That rep reveals little changes. We observe the head bob that suggests a sore wrist, a brand-new hitch in the hips on staircases, the means an usually steady belly generates soft stool two days running. A message with a quick video clip frequently triggers a preventive veterinarian check out that conserves bigger difficulty later. Security understanding prolongs past the pet dog. Durham has city wild animals, from hawks to the strange prairie wolf discovery at dawn near wooded sides. We maintain canines on leash per neighborhood guidelines, check for foxtails and burrs, lug tick eliminators, and avoid warm asphalt at noontime. I have rescheduled strolls to shaded loopholes a lot more times than I can count when a warmth advising hit, and proprietors thanked me later.
6. Genuine comfort for complicated schedules
Shifts alter. A meeting runs long. A child wakes up with a fever. A canine walking solution takes in that changability. Many developed dog pedestrians in Durham provide timetable home windows, very same day add if you reserve early, and application based updates. You get a GPS map, a few photos, and a brief note about state of mind, poop, and anything significant. Even if you remain in a lab or scrubbed in, you can insured and bonded dog walkers eye your phone and know your pet is covered. The psychological lift is genuine. Clients typically state the updates assist them focus at the workplace, then stroll in the door ready to delight Durham NC dog walking in the evening rather than shuffle to deal with a mess.
7. A calmer home life
When a dog's demands are fulfilled reliably, they bark much less at squirrels, eat fewer footwear, and settle faster after supper. That changes the feeling of your home. I consider one couple in Trinity Park whose young vizsla shouted whenever they left. We established a 30 minute smell walk at 11, then a 15 min potty brake with 2 short training games at 3. Within 3 weeks, their neighbors stopped texting concerning noise. They started welcoming buddies over once more. The pet found out that daily has beats, and anxiousness lost its grip.
What a professional canine strolling solution usually provides in Durham
Service menus vary, however you will see patterns throughout the much better dog strolling services in Durham, NC. Basic browse through sizes hover at 20, 30, and 60 minutes. Some use 45 mins, which works well in severe weather condition or for dogs who do finest with a brisk loop and a few minutes of indoor play. Many companies use a scheduling application that confirms time home windows, logs the walk route, and allows you update feeding or drug notes.
Solo strolls suit reactive, elderly, or medically complex canines. Paired or small team walks can decrease price and include safe social time, however ask what team dimension implies in practice. I seldom see greater than 2 dogs per walker on city walkways. 3 is a tough limit I suggest for tracks with large courses. Off leash adventures audio exciting, yet true off chain is uncommon in Durham as a result of chain legislations and safety and security. A trustworthy dog walker will keep your canine leashed unless on personal property with consent, and they will certainly tell you that up front.
Expect basic equipment administration, like wiping paws after rain, rejuvenating water, and towel drying if required. A lot of walkers carry a tiny set, poop bags, spare slip lead, a collapsible water bowl, and paw balm in winter months. Keys are stored in lockboxes or coded systems, and insurance coverage needs to cover vital loss. If your canine requires noontime drug, verify the service's plan on administering pills or drops. Lots of will do it, yet they will desire a signed guideline sheet and probably a quick demo.
Pricing in context, and what impacts it
Rates relocate with experience, insurance, and browse through length. In Durham, a 20 min check out typically lands between 18 and 28 bucks, a thirty minutes browse through in between 22 and 35 bucks, and a 60 minute check out between 35 and 55 dollars. Add ons like a 2nd pet dog can be a tiny fee, often 3 to 8 bucks, depending upon the dimension and dealing with requirements. Weekend break, holiday, or late night ports might lug surcharges. Solo responsive pet trips set you back more than an easygoing paired stroll, not since anyone is penalizing the dog, but due to the fact that two hands, two eyes, and a vast buffer are dedicated to one animal.
Be cautious of prices that appear also low. Employees require training, time cushioning for emergency situations, and rest. A lasting pet walking solution pays fairly, keeps insurance coverage, and can absorb the periodic puncture without terminating your canine's day.
How to select the best dog walker in Durham, NC
Plenty of search results appear when you type dog walker Durham NC. Sorting them takes judgment, and you do not require an advanced degree to do it well. Beginning with insurance and experience, then view just how a pedestrian interacts with your canine and with you. Focus on the little points, like preparation at the meet and greet and the clarity of their communication. Request recommendations from clients with pets similar book a dog walker online to yours, not simply beautiful generalities.
Here is a small checklist that maintains the essentials front and center:
- Proof of business insurance, bonding, and employees' compensation if they have employees, plus a clear plan for tricks or lockboxes.
- Training approach that makes use of rewards and humane handling, with specifics on just how they handle pulling, barking, or abrupt lunges.
- Experience with your canine's profile, for example, huge teenage dogs, seniors with joint inflammation, or leash reactive dogs.
- Clear check out framework, timing windows, and back-up plan if your primary pedestrian is sick or stuck, with general practitioner or picture updates.
- Transparent rates, cancellation terms, holiday additional charges, and exactly how they deal with extreme warm, storms, or ice.
When you fulfill, enjoy your dog. A good pedestrian gives a pet room to smell and approach initially, kneels sidewards instead of impending, and stays clear of harsh patting today. They manage chains smoothly, inspect harness fit, and ask where your canine likes to go. If your pet is timid or responsive, a silent very first browse through without pressure to walk far might be the right call.
Local context that matters more than you think
Durham and bordering districts impose leash and pet dog waste pick-up guidelines. A professional need to mention this without motivating. Ask how they path on warm days, wet days, and during leaf pickup when pathways obtain obstructed. In summer, shaded paths along creeks or in older neighborhoods with high trees make an actual distinction for brachycephalic types. In winter season, some pathways remain icy long after the sunlight hits others, specifically on north dealing with hills. People that stroll daily in your part of community know where the safe footing is.
Traffic timing is an additional quiet element. Around institutions, termination windows develop clusters of cars and children with mobility scooters, which can alarm noise sensitive pets. A walker that recognizes to shift 20 mins previously that week deserves their fee.
Interview inquiries and 5 subtle red flags
You will have your very own list of concerns. Include a few that move past the website gloss. Ask them to explain a current walk that did not go to strategy and what they transformed. Ask how they would heat up a high energy dog on a humid day to prevent overheating. Ask for a brief trial of just how they take care of a pull toward a squirrel. Responses that appear resided in are what you want.
Watch for these red flags that frequently forecast headaches later:
- Vague or prideful responses about insurance policy or emergency situation planning.
- Reliance on aversive devices without your authorization, such as sliding prong collars or using chain stands out as a default.
- Overpromising, like walking four or 5 dogs at the same time on downtown sidewalks, or guaranteeing that a reactive canine will be fine in big teams within a week.
- Thin communication, late replies during the test week, or inconsistent stroll windows without heads up.
- Indifference to weather modifications, like demanding lengthy midday asphalt walks during a heat advisory.
Three usual scenarios, and exactly how a great dog walker adapts
A 6 month old puppy in Lakewood. Potty training is primarily there, however lunch break is unstable. The pedestrian sets 2 midday gos to for the first 2 weeks, a 15 min relief at 11 and a 20 min walk at 2 with two straightforward training games. They reduce the walk on warm days, provide water, and log each pee and poop. Within a month, the owner goes down to one thirty minutes lunchtime see because the dog is reliably holding between 10 and 3.
A responsive guard near Southpoint. The canine aggresses bikes and joggers. The walker selects quieter streets at 10 a.m., after that makes use of distance from triggers, gratifying check ins. They maintain the dog beside comfort and never ever push with sensitivity. Over 4 to 6 weeks, the guard can pass a jogger at 30 feet without barking, then 20 feet. Not excellent, however workable, and the proprietor feels safe again.
An elderly beagle downtown with creaky hips. Staircases are hard in the early morning. The pedestrian times gos to after discomfort meds, makes use of a back harness assist if required, and picks level loopholes with turf shoulders. They massage therapy paws after icy days and spray a little water on the belly during warmth. The pet returns home content, not hopping, and the proprietor's veterinarian records secure weight and far better mobility.
Working partnership, just how to make it smooth
Start with a clear profile. Include routines, health and wellness notes, where the harness hangs, how to stay clear of the next-door neighbor's yappy fencing line, and your dog's favorite reward. Walkers move quicker and more secure when they do not need to guess. Establish sensible time windows and select a key accessibility system that does not need everyday sychronisation. During the initial week, inspect the app notes, respond if something looks off, and deal responses. Two or 3 little program improvements early on prevent longer term drift from your preferences.
If your schedule whipsaws, package changes when you can. Lots of dog strolling services plan paths the evening prior to. A solitary message which contains all week updates beats a string of private pings. Keep emergency situation contacts existing. If you know a tornado is coming, preauthorize the walker to reduce exterior time and extend indoor enrichment, like nose work with a couple of treats concealed under cups.
Most canines gain from consistency, yet a percentage of uniqueness keeps them interested. Weekly or 2, ask the walker to choose a new loop or include a short pattern game at the end. That tweak stimulates the brain without ramping arousal.
The role of training and boundaries
A dog walker is not a replacement for a fitness instructor, but a skilled pedestrian strengthens the policies you establish. If you are showing loose chain strolling, agree on signs and rewards. If your dog can not welcome on leash, the pedestrian must mirror that limit and reroute with a simple rest and treat as other pet dogs pass. When everyone deals with the canine the same way, development sticks.
Be thoughtful concerning gear. Harnesses that clip at the upper body can minimize drawing for some canines and aggravate motion for others. Collars must have 2 finger slack, harness straps must sit free from shoulder blades. Share your veterinarian's suggestions on orthopedic problems or any kind of restrictions. The most effective dog pedestrians durham has will certainly ask to readjust the strategy if they notice chafing or if stride adjustments after 15 minutes.
Where to look, and exactly how to verify
Referrals still beat algorithms. Ask your vet technology, your neighbor with the calm Laboratory, your structure supervisor. Many of the stable dog strolling services Durham NC residents count on maintain a low advertising profile since they are scheduled through word of mouth. If you do browse online, integrate "pet dog strolling service Durham" with your community name. Read evaluations, however evaluate specifics over celebrity matters. A testimonial that claims, "They rerouted to shade during recently's warmth advisory and brought additional water for my pug," deserves 10 generic raves.
Schedule a paid test week before making a month-to-month commitment. Book 3 to five brows through throughout various times. Examine punctuality within the agreed home window, the high quality of notes, how your dog welcomes the walker on day 3, and whether tiny concerns obtain smoothed quickly. If your dog returns unwinded, drinks water, then naps, you get on track. If your canine spins at the door for an hour after the pedestrian leaves, or you see mounting reactivity, readjust or reconsider.
Weather, security, and sensible expectations
Durham summertimes will test also healthy pet dogs. On 95 level days with high moisture, your dog does not require distance, they require secure engagement. A 15 to 20 min shaded smell walk with water and a cool towel within is frequently the right telephone call. Great solutions interact these adjustments and do not excuse securing your pet. Also, throughout electrical storms, several canines stop at the door. Compeling them out produces battles. A pedestrian must pivot to indoor enrichment, potty ideally throughout lulls, and keep you informed.
Traffic and building shift rapidly around here. Walkway closures appear without caution. I have actually transformed a set up loophole right into a cul-de-sac figure just to prevent a loud backhoe. The metric is not miles, it is top quality. If your pet dog gets 5 strong minutes of loosened leash technique, three calm direct exposures to delivery trucks, and a clean potty break, that is an effective lunchtime browse through on a loud day.
